Transaction 34ac64e7f58af2f01dc80bc073587aab1d35d2b7fd64f6ee7c7795a9f6e65e0b

1 Input
2 Outputs
  • 34ac64e7f58af2f01dc80bc073587aab1d35d2b7fd64f6ee7c7795a9f6e65e0b:0
  • value  1226408
    address  33F4ARFrhb8sKhGJTwAJouv3pRBmRMmSvz
  • 34ac64e7f58af2f01dc80bc073587aab1d35d2b7fd64f6ee7c7795a9f6e65e0b:1
  • value  7265578
    address  17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b